North American satellite operator places $4 million order for Sandvine's PTS 32000, business intelligence, traffic optimization


WATERLOO, ON, May 5, 2016 /CNW/ - Sandvine, (TSX:SVC) a leading provider of intelligent broadband network solutions for fixed and mobile operators, today announced that it has received an order from a North American satellite operator for approximately $4 million.

After a highly competitive technical evaluation, the satellite operator chose Sandvine's market-leading 100GE Policy Traffic Switch (PTS) 32000 to displace their existing network policy control solution. Sandvine's network policy control platform will be used by the operator to enable business intelligence and traffic optimization solutions that will ensure their subscribers enjoy a high quality of experience when using the Internet.

In its 2 rack unit (RU) form factor, the PTS 32000 delivers PCEF/TDF functionality for fixed, mobile, and satellite operators at the highest scale, with the best performance density (Gbps/RU) and performance efficiency (Gbps/watt) of any 100GE network policy control device.

"Sandvine's Traffic Optimization solutions are well-suited to address satellite operators' challenges in dealing with network latency," said Tom Donnelly, Sandvine's COO, Sales and Global Services. "This order further demonstrates the success we have had in the satellite market and how operators recognize the role Sandvine can play in improving the overall Internet experience for their subscribers."

ABOUT SANDVINE
Sandvine's network policy control solutions add intelligenceto fixed, mobile and converged communications service provider networks, to increase revenue, reduce network costs and improve subscriber quality of experience. Our networking solutions perform end-to-end policy control functions, including traffic classification, policy decision and enforcement. Deployed as virtualized network functions or on Sandvine's purpose built hardware, the products provide actionable business insight, and the ability to deploy new consumer and business subscriber services, optimize and secure network traffic, and engage with subscribers.



Sandvine's network policy control solutions are deployed in more than 300 networks in over 100 countries, serving hundreds of millions of data subscribers worldwide. www.sandvine.com.
